Tanze: Wikki fans want me!

Shammah Tanze has revealed that the fans and everyone at Wikki Tourist wanted him back at the Abubarkar Tafawa Balewa Stadium.
The former Nasarawa United forward had previously played for the Bauchi Elephants, but the overwhelming clamour to have him back motivated his decision complete a move.
“It’s an amazing experience to be loved and wanted by the fans,” Tanze said.
“I joined the team in Kaduna for the Shehu Dikko preseason tournament where Wikki Tourist emerged as champions and I was the highest goal scorer with three goals. I believe that this is just the beginning of good things by his grace.
“Wikki Tourist wanted me because of my experience to have played on the continent and also reached the 2016 Federation Cup final. A deal has been agreed to with Nasarawa United and both clubs have agreed not to disclose the details.”
Wikki Tourist left Lokoja on Tuesday for Enugu ahead of the 2016 Super 4 scheduled to kick- off today.
